Album Notes

His performance entertains audiences with a creative blend of mood setting music that can be relaxing, calm, and romantic. He performs in a variety of venues, from campus coffeehouses to outdoor festivals.

Ryann has had the honor of being featured live on Cleveland's WJW-Fox TV Morning News and Ohio NPR stations WCPN, and WAPS. Ryann can infuse classical music, soothing guitar lines by artists like Eric Clapton and Nick Drake, and energetic, lively pieces by artists like Bob Marley and Stevie Wonder.
